For your purpose, You basically need a disconnected Calendar table. To create a new field parameter, on the Modeling tab, select New parameter > Fields. Add columns to field parameters. First, create a new blank query in Power Query. Step-1: Under Modeling Tab > Click on New Parameter > Choose Fields. Note that Power Query is case-sensitive) Click on Apply changes; And after the refresh, the data from the new data source will be in the visualization; Congratulations! Part 3: Using Azure Data Explorer with Power BI Dynamic Parameters. Download Free Resources Here Creating A Dynamic Date Table Using Live Data In Query Editor click "Manage Parameters" from the ribbon. Home; Leadership. You'll require to meet the following requirements to be able to follow this post: First, let's define SelectedStates and SelectedSources parameters in our model. Su. If a user Read more about Dynamic Date Range from Slicer[…] Prerequisites Field Parameters. Apply changes. Give the Parameter a name (I used Test) Set a Current Value of 0. Get the Guide The Maximum is 0.50 (50 percent). The first step is to create the parameter under Power Query Editor window (this parameter is different from What IF parameters in Power BI Desktop) Then set the parameter name, data type and the default value: Using the parameter as the source database This approach worked great initially, but my date parameters do not change dynamically when a new file is downloaded. you have a report with dynamic data source type now. how to pass today date as dynamic input date in power bi advanced editor? Career Model; Proactive Mentorship . In this article, we are going to create a report which: 1. Dynamic Date slicer - Microsoft Power BI Community top community.powerbi.com - One slicer that has 'Date 1', 'Date 2', Date 3' - One date slicer, that will slice based on the selection from the above slicer So if a user chooses 'Date 1' in the first slicer, the second date slicer (with the range selector) will then filter the table by that date, if they choose Date 2, it will then be that date. You can also convert a parameter to a query by right-clicking the parameter and then selecting Convert . To pass Yesterday dynamic date: datetime = Date.ToText(Date.AddDays(Date.From(DateTime.FixedLocalNow()),-1), "yyyyMMdd") Step 1: open the report, open query editor window (Transform Tab) The Future of Big Data With some guidance, you can craft a data platform that is right for your organization's needs and gets the most return from your data capital. In this video, Patrick shows you how you can use a parameter, within a Power BI report, to dynamically change the data in a report. I need to do a query on this database to give me a list of invoice numbers for invoices that contain part numbers for a specific vendor. Step 2: Now, we will see below What If Analysis parameter window. This allows users the flexibility and control to customize how they consume FactSet's IRN using Power BI's data visualizations. Let's see how we can apply dynamic filtering using parameter to get desired result. @SalesDate parameter The parameter @SalesDate is data type DateTime. You should see code that looks like this: Set up Field Parameters So I would like Power BI to filter my data based on the last 12 month up till March . The following shows a Web API URL configured in Power BI Desktop for connecting the Power BI Data Model to Dynamics 365 (Online). We've also set the Increment to 0.05, or five percent. It's a similar pattern, I see what he's doing with creating a second FY filter table to put next to a date-slicer, and it works - selecting a date range changes the FY periods slicer. Fields parameters is a feature that allows users to choose which column to use to slice and dice values in a Power BI visual. Follow the below steps to create a parameter slicer for a discount amount. In Power BI Desktop, select Home > Transform data > Transform data to open the Power Query Editor. We'll define 2 parameters of type Text, mark them as required, and provide a default value: Next, we need to bind each one of these parameters to the respective column in the dimension tables. My Question is I have . 2. Create a field parameter. This assumes SQL is using a date field. Create a query "Students" to get the data from the spreadsheet 6. Modified 2 years ago. Parameter, ranging from 0 to 10 million, incrementing by 1 million, with a default of 5 million This creates a table in my model with two columns: Sales Threshold , which contains my series data . Field Parameters. To modify the date, type a new date in the text box or use the calendar control. Step-2: Parameters window will appear, now choose the columns to whom you want to change dynamically. Switch from months to weeks, to days effortlessly to drill down into the data, and choose between panning and selecting as your filtering method. It is not recommended to do it the other way around. Click "New". If you have any questions or comments please leave them in the area below. Steps in the Video: 1. Steps. Featuring vast interaction options and smooth animations, combine multiple chart types for the ultimate Power BI timeline experience. You can read the rest of the posts here: Part 1: Querying Azure Data Explorer using Power BI. In orginal query now you want the current week in this format you can write the code like this. This uses M Functions wit. To do this, go in to the Power Query editor and…. In the following image, we've created a parameter called Discount percentage and set its data type to Decimal number. In this example, the Data Model is connected to the Dynamics 365 (Online) development instance for an organisation named "Acme"; i.e. It generates a date table based on the date parameters that you put in. How to dynamically switch between measures using Field Parameters 1. ; Reference the existing date dimension query and use standard M functions to select the week ending date column and the dynamic Calendar Month Status column described in Chapter 5, Creating Power BI Dashboards and Chapter 6, Getting Serious with Date Intelligence: Above is my Stored Procedure in Query Editor its running fine and getting data as i am passing all parameters dynamically including Server Name and Databasename. Power BI allows you to use parameters to make your reports dynamic. View this on YouTube > Dynamic TopN made easy with What If Parameter.pbix. To create a new field parameter, on the Modeling tab, select New parameter > Fields. To create a what-if parameter, select New Parameter from the Modeling tab in Power BI Desktop. Two of the new features in the Power BI Desktop April Update are Query Parameters and Power BI Template files. Click New again if you have more parameters to add. By creating a fields parameter you can very easily build a report where the user can slice by Brand and Category, as in the following figure. Other data sources can also be integrated to further enhance the Power BI experience. Dynamic date parameter query. Power Query - Dynamic Data Source and Web.Contents () This is the first post in a series to create a Star Wars report. "acmedev". The BringValue table is running a KQL query. It will not refresh in the Power BI service unless you do some tricks. Once that's in place, I'm going to show you how to make the table dynamic based on the actual data you have. Ensure that Field Parameters is turned on in Preview Features Firstly, navigate to Options and Settings > Options > Preview Features, and ensure that Field Parameters is enabled. contact sales: (855) FLUENT-8 or (855) 358-3688. . When the User changed the value of the disconnected Table using a Slicer. . This warranted a second look to see where we're now and where we're going. 2 Answers. Then using a gateway to enable refresh. The BringValue table is running a KQL query. This parameter can be also changed from the Power BI service under the dataset settings; @ShowAll parameter The parameter @ShowAll is data type Boolean. Then I next put in the divisor for our Mod which was 12 due to their being the 12 months of the year highlighted in ORANGE; The final part is where I had to increment the number by 1 to show the correct Fiscal Month Sort Order highlighted in BLUE; Then in order to create the Fiscal Quarter and Fiscal Quarter Sort Number I . Now if I change the parameter to 10, and the current date being 31 Aug 2017, . To get started you first need to enable the Field parameters preview feature. Script Execution: "Run". Let's go over the process on how to setup a period table so that you can have a dynamic date range for your Power BI Report in this video.Here are the links . . In this blog post, we will take a deeper look at the new capabilities and scenarios that these two features enable in Power BI. In this article, Robert Sheldon demonstrates how parameters can be used to substitute connection information, query filters, or even calculations within the query. In a previous blog from October 2020, I ranted about the narrow list of data sources supported by Power BI Dynamic M query parameters. I had to do this in order to get the number for our Mod to be correct. The FactSet Power BI Data Connector leverages the power of FactSet's IRN API to integrate research data into Power BI. Access the complete Power BI Parameters Playlist here: https://www.youtube.com/watch?v=twBUmqVOGgg&list=PL7GQQXV5Z8edKDvKYzglGfCwKo3HvTToS Download Powe. I had to do this in order to get the number for our Mod to be correct. By creating a fields parameter you can very easily build a report where the user can slice by Brand and Category, as in the following figure. Ask Question Asked 3 years, 3 months ago. In this article, you'll start with a new Power BI project and use the sample data to create a report that uses a slicer to filter data in a dynamic M query linked to a KQL function. My parameter FromDate from the newest daily download increases with a new download because the value in that column increases, but my filter still uses the "Current Value" I designated when I created the parameter. Right Click on trip fares to get to advanced editor This uses M Functions within Power Query and a second source that has the key values to pull. which will then make the TSQL query dynamic. You'll learn more about Query Parameters in the next articles "Power BI Desktop Query Parameters, Part 2, SQL Server Dynamic Data Masking Use Case" and "Power BI Query Parameters, Part 3, List Output" Requirements. In the attached file, you see two tables. Power BI (Visual Contest, On the Go, Hyperlinks, Drill Up, Drill Down, tyGraph Content Pack) - SQL Server 2016 - CTP 2.3 (SSAS Tabular . Create a parameter (StudentID) 3. The value is provided by a Power Query parameter bound to the column value in the table Values. The prompt Select the Date appears next to the text box. Su. Add columns to field parameters. The query returns a table with one row and one column called Value. Viewed 1k times . . I have a table (it's a Synapse SQL view of a table in a Dynamics 365 Finance fed Data Lake) that lists invoices from 1000's of sales of different part numbers. Although there is no indication, Power BI has two types of connectors: native and M-based. First of all you need to open Power BI - Options and Settings - Options Its in Preview so make sure that is ticked before continuing Get Data Azure SQL Database (The guidance mentions SQL Server but it seems that both can be used for this test) Load Then go to Transform data. 7. The latest version of Power BI Desktop (Version: 2.34.4372.322 64-bit (April 2016) or later) SQL Server 2016: Check this out to see how you can download SQL Server 2016 Developer edition for free. Parameters allow them to make parts of reports depend on one or more parameter values.For example, a report creator may create a parameter that restricts the data to a single country/region, or a parameter that defines acceptable formats for fields like dates, time, and text. Change the name to "Product Category". Note: As Dynamic Data Masking (DDM) is a new feature of SQL Server 2016 and it is not available in the previous versions of SQL . Power BI tips from the Pros - LIVE (May 28, 2022) (Member Chat 2nd Half) . In the Query Editor, create a new blank query and name it WeekEndDatesParamList. You'll also see the date parameters in the same order they were listed earlier. First Go to Power Query Editor, Next click in Manage Parameters tab in Ribbon Bar after that select New Parameter from context menu as shown below. All was dandy locally, but refresh failed on the PBI service with this: This dataset includes a dynamic data source. Modified 3 years, . In this article. Note that for every query you invoke, the corresponding query function will show up here. In our sample this parameter is not required so un-tick "Required". Power Query provides two easy ways to create parameters: From an existing query: Right-click a query whose value is a simple non-structured constant, such as a date, text, or number, and then select Convert to Parameter. Dates_disconnected = SELECTCOLUMNS ( Dates, "Date",Dates [Date] ) Now, create your Date . . In the Power BI May 2022 Feature Summary, a new preview feature called Field Parameters has been released.Field Parameters allow you to dynamically change the measure being analysed within a report. The value is provided by a Power Query parameter bound to the column value in the table Values. Then I next put in the divisor for our Mod which was 12 due to their being the 12 months of the year highlighted in ORANGE; The final part is where I had to increment the number by 1 to show the correct Fiscal Month Sort Order highlighted in BLUE; Then in order to create the Fiscal Quarter and Fiscal Quarter Sort Number I . Users can define new parameters by using the . It doesn't apply to DirectQuery connections to most relational databases. In order to make the parameter Dynamic, we create a new disconnected Table (not connected to any other Tables in the Model) Then we Bind the Value of the Column Day to the Parameter. Step-2: Parameters window will appear, now choose the columns to whom you want to change dynamically. Copy paste this code into a new blank query and call it DateToYYYYWW. It shows four date parameters - a required StartDate, a required EndDate, an optional FYStartMonth and an optional holiday list. Go to Home --> Manage Parameters --> New Parameter. Dynamic date parameter query. Have you ever needed to allow your Power BI Report Users to change between multiple fields on the X-axis?With the recently announced Field Parameters in Powe. (US Date format - your format might show 19/10/2019 depending on system setttings.) Shows a sum of a specific value of a column and also how to add formatting on the data. Select the Field parameters checkbox. I have a table (it's a Synapse SQL view of a table in a Dynamics 365 Finance fed Data Lake) that lists invoices from 1000's of sales of different part numbers. Part one of two of my videos on creating a Power Query Calendar Table. Select the Field parameters checkbox. Part 2: Using dimensions when querying Azure Data Explorer using Power BI. RoundDown((Date.DayOfYear(dDate)-(Date.DayOfWeek(dDate, Day.Monday) +1)+10)/7)),2) in Quelle. In this article, you'll start with a new Power BI project and use the sample data to create a report that uses a slicer to filter data in a dynamic M query linked to a KQL function. = Date.AddYears (DateTime.Date (DateTime.LocalNow ()), -1) This will create a scalar value of 10/12/2019 - one year ago. Click OK. Next, right click the Parameter in the Queries pane on the left and go to the Advanced Editor. Lydia September 23, 2020 at 2:18 am I tired your code on a graph , I have a database consisting of schools, the final average grade( for the last exams in the whole year) and an annual average grade. Considering your calendar table name Dates. In the attached file, you see two tables. Dynamic Power BI reports using Parameters: In this video, Patrick shows you how you can use a parameter, within a Power BI report, to dynamically change the data in a report. the preceding 10 months of data. The template is a text file that needs to be placed in the query editor. Select New Parameters under the Manage Parameters button in the ribbon. This uses M Functions within Power Query and a second source that has the key values to pull. The query is is arguable the simplest query you can run in KQL : print Value='Value'. And here we are: Creating a New Query Parameter and Link it to the List Query: Now it is time to create a query parameter and link to the List Query. With Dynamic M parameters, you can create Power BI reports that give viewers the ability to use filters or slicers to set values for KQL query parameters. Power BI pass parameter to python script. Step-1: Under Modeling Tab > Click on New Parameter > Choose Fields. Report creators add query parameters to reports in Power BI Desktop. The query returns a table with one row and one column called Value. Unfortunately, a better name of this feature would have been Kusto Dynamic Parameters since the primary design intent was to support Azure Data Explorer (internally named Kusto). I'm pulling data from GitHub Codeowners into a Power BI report. In Power BI Desktop, go to File > Options and settings > Options > Preview features. Power BI Report: How to pass Dynamic Values to Parameters in Report Made with Stored Procedure. It is done just to get to know that data that is being displayed by report is connected either from Dev or Prod Database's table. Next, restart Power BI Desktop to begin using the Field Parameters feature. Sorted by: 1. The February 2022 update of Power BI Desktop expanded the feature reach to relational data sources, such as SQL Server (all flavors), Oracle, Teradata, and SAP. Access the complete Power BI Parameters Playlist here: https://www.youtube.com/watch?v=twBUmqVOGgg&list=PL7GQQXV5Z8edKDvKYzglGfCwKo3HvTToS Download Powe. Fields parameters is a feature that allows users to choose which column to use to slice and dice values in a Power BI visual. AdventureWorksDW. Create a function for "Query1" GetStudentDetails (StudentID). ; Reference the existing date dimension query and use standard M functions to select the week ending date column and the dynamic Calendar Month Status column described in Chapter 5, Creating Power BI Dashboards and Chapter 6, Getting Serious with Date Intelligence: . In the Query Editor, create a new blank query and name it WeekEndDatesParamList. Creating a parameter. In Power BI Desktop, go to File > Options and settings > Options > Preview features. Data Model and report layers in Power BI Desktop. Change "Type . Then using a gateway to enable refresh. Configuring the Dynamic Parameters in Power BI. Now we need to create a parameter to see total sales if the discount is given at different percentage values. Considering your fact table name your_fact_table_name. The FactSet Power BI Data Connector leverages the power of FactSet's IRN API to integrate research data into Power BI. In the steps below I am going to explain how to get our Parameter Value for the Fiscal Start Month into a table in the Query Editor Go into the Query Editor Then click on New Source, and select Blank Query Now in my Example I name the Query "Parameter - Fiscal Start Year" Next I clicked on Advanced Editor I then put in the following M Code let Some data source connections in Power BI Desktop—such as SharePoint, Salesforce Objects, and SQL Server . Power BI reporting. This is the fourth post in this series, discussing the usage of Power BI to visualize Azure Data Explorer data. It is recommended to use Power Query parameters for making the data transformation dynamic, and What if parameter, to make DAX expression dynamic. However, if you take his FY slicer & choose "2019", (my) users expect the date slicer to re-adjust to only show dates within 2019 (1/1/19-12/31/19) - and it doesn . Since dynamic dat. Step-3: Now add one matrix visual and drag Parameters in Rows, and add some values as in values section. A recent post on a community.powerbi.com forum asked if it was possible to show a slicer of months, and configure a report so when a user selects a single month from the slicer, visuals will show data for a date range relative to that selection e.g. Other data sources can also be integrated to further enhance the Power BI experience. Create Dynamic Query Parameters, filter your reports with them and create a template using Power BI.Links mentioned in the video:Chris Webb blog: https://blo. Steps. This feature helps end-users to easily explore different metrics in a visual by selecting the measure they're interested in within a slicer. Edit Query 1 to use the Paremter instead of a hard coded value 4. Advanced Data Filtering in Power BI: How to Use Dynamic Parameters for Creating Universal Reports? I need to do a query on this database to give me a list of invoice numbers for invoices that contain part numbers for a specific vendor. Step 1: Go to the "Modeling" tab and click on "New Parameter.". Or, by simply choosing a different selection in the slicer, the report slices . Dynamic Power BI reports using Parameters. The report is easy to support, it gives the ability to customize Power BI data filtering criteria without modifications. This post handles the issue of using a parameter as the url in a web Power Query. In this video we'll see two methods for creating either a dynamic or relative date ran. You can create a separate custom table for all dates as below-. Prerequisites Reply. Skip to content. Ask Question Asked 2 years, 4 months ago. Create a spreadsheet that holds the Parameter values 5. The Minimum value is zero. Use this as the formula. After clicking on New Parameter, a Manage Parameters dialog box . here are some bad practices: Using What If parameters to change the server address from Dev to Test or to Prod. The query is is arguable the simplest query you can run in KQL : print Value='Value'. Write a query "Query1" 2. Step-3: Now add one matrix visual and drag Parameters in Rows, and add some values as in values section. Use the radio buttons to specify True or False. As we can see from the image above Power query recognized the parameter param1, now we can run the python script and dynamically change the value assigned to the new column. The Value get passed to the Parameter which Change the Value of the Column "Dynamic . With Dynamic M parameters, you can create Power BI reports that give viewers the ability to use filters or slicers to set values for KQL query parameters. within a Power BI report, to dynamically change the data in a report. Learn more about this mechanism. I was forced to modify my custom function to accept the entire URL as a parameter . . This type of data source is referred to as a Dynamic Data Source. Create a field parameter. Rename the query varStartDate Or, by simply choosing a different selection in the slicer, the report slices . Then fill out the following information about the Parameter. To get started you first need to enable the Field parameters preview feature. Among the main features of Drill Down TimeSeries PRO you will find: Click on OK. We will then create a Power BI Desktop model with Query Parameters on top of DimCustomer table. This allows users the flexibility and control to customize how they consume FactSet's IRN using Power BI's data visualizations. As I promised in my earlier post, in this article I show you how to leverage your Power BI Desktop model using Query Parameters on top of SQL Server 2016 Dynamic Data Masking (DDM).I also explain very briefly how to enable DDM on DimCustomer table from AdventureWorksDW2016CTP3 database.

Foods To Avoid With Blepharitis, Superior Police Department, Ccny Academic Calendar Spring 2022, Terry Richardson Website, Apartments For Rent In Farmingdale, Ny By Owner, Cultural Diffusion During The Age Of Exploration, Harrison Bakery Half Moon Cookie Recipe, Worst Estate In Liverpool, Hendrick Middle School Directory, Seattle Seahawks Draft Picks 2023,